seroreconstruct: Reconstructing Antibody Dynamics to Estimate the Risk of Influenza Virus Infection

A Bayesian framework for inferring influenza infection status from serial antibody measurements. Jointly estimates season-specific infection probabilities, antibody boosting and waning after infection, and baseline hemagglutination inhibition (HAI) titer distributions via Markov chain Monte Carlo (MCMC). Supports multi-season analysis and subgroup comparisons via a group_by interface. See Tsang et al. (2022) <doi:10.1038/s41467-022-29310-8> for methodological details.
